Capital International Sarl increased its holdings in shares of Brookfield Asset Management Ltd. (NYSE:BAM - Free Report) TSE: BAM.A by 7.1% in the fourth quarter, according to the company in its most recent fil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C). The firm owned 235,964 shares of the financial services provider's stock after purchasing an additional 15,661 shares during the period. Capital International Sarl owned 0.05% of Brookfield Asset Management worth $12,787,000 as of its most recent SEC filing.

Brookfield Asset Management Stock Performance
Brookfield Asset Management stock traded up $2.07 during trading on Tuesday, reaching $49.35. The company had a trading volume of 909,598 shares, compared to its average volume of 1,429,973. The firm has a market capitalization of $80.81 billion, a price-to-earnings ratio of 37.41, a PEG ratio of 1.92 and a beta of 1.63. Brookfield Asset Management Ltd. has a 12-month low of $37.29 and a 12-month high of $62.61. The stock's 50 day moving average price is $50.84 and its two-hundred day moving average price is $53.66.
Brookfield Asset Management (NYSE:BAM - Get Free Report) TSE: BAM.A last issued its earnings results on Wednesday, February 12th. The financial services provider reported $0.40 earnings per share for the quarter, topping the consensus estimate of $0.39 by $0.01. Brookfield Asset Management had a return on equity of 81.16% and a net margin of 54.47%. As a group, research analysts expect that Brookfield Asset Management Ltd. will post 1.7 earnings per share for the current year.
Brookfield Asset Management Increases Dividend
The firm also recently declared a quarterly dividend, which was paid on Monday, March 31st. Investors of record on Friday, February 28th were issued a $0.4375 dividend. This is a positive change from Brookfield Asset Management's previous quarterly dividend of $0.38. The ex-dividend date of this dividend was Friday, February 28th. This represents a $1.75 annualized dividend and a yield of 3.55%. Brookfield Asset Management's dividend payout ratio (DPR) is presently 132.58%.

About Brookfield Asset Management
(
Free Report)
Brookfield Asset Management Ltd. is a real estate investment firm specializing in alternative asset management services. Its renewable power and transition business includes the operates in the hydroelectric, wind, solar, distributed generation, and sustainable solution sector. The company's infrastructure business engages in the utilities, transport, midstream, and data infrastructure sectors.
